PARENTS sending their children to secondary school can find out more about the choices available to them at an open day.

Greenwich Council is holding a drop-in session, at the town hall in Wellington Street, Woolwich, between noon and 7pm on June 30.

The event will allow visitors to learn more about secondary schools in the borough.

There will also be information on specialist education services, such as support for gifted students and programmes for those who need additional help.

Member for lifelong learning Councillor Angela Cornforth said: "Every Greenwich school is different and has its own positive aspects to offer children.

"This event will give parents and children alike the chance to find this out for themselves."
